A steak and stout pie is a savory dish consisting of tender pieces of beef steak cooked in a rich and hearty stout-based gravy, then enclosed in a pastry crust and baked until golden brown. The stout, a dark beer, adds depth of flavor to the filling, complementing the beef and other ingredients.
